Question
- which statement about the electromagnetic radiation in space is true? select all that apply
humans can see all radiation from earth.
visible light is the only type of radiation that provides useful information.
astronomers use many types of telescopes to detect different kinds of radiation.
every star, including the sun, emits radiation of many different kinds.
Brief Explanations
- For "Humans can see all radiation from Earth": Humans can only see visible light (a part of electromagnetic radiation), not all types (e.g., radio waves, X - rays are invisible to the naked eye), so this is false.
- For "Visible light is the only type of radiation that provides useful information": Astronomers use non - visible radiation (like radio waves, infrared) for useful info (e.g., radio telescopes for celestial radio emissions), so this is false.
- For "Astronomers use many types of telescopes to detect different kinds of radiation": Astronomers use radio telescopes (for radio waves), X - ray telescopes (for X - rays), optical telescopes (for visible light), etc., to detect different electromagnetic radiations, so this is true.
- For "Every star, including the Sun, emits radiation of many different kinds": Stars emit a spectrum of electromagnetic radiation (visible, infrared, ultraviolet, etc.), so this is true.
